Question 94 F150 5.0 want to change differentials

My son has a 94 F150 with a 4 inch Suspension lift and running 35X12.5X15

He has stock gears and has been told to change out to 410... is that correct... looking of others to either confirm or say stay with stock.. he just wants to get better mileage and less wear and tear on the engine.. and won't be taking it into mud bogs or anything like that...

is it two wheel drive or four the reason I ask is if you it's four wheel drive then you have to change both differentials to keep the transfer case from being ruined or shelled out. when trying to improve mpg the higher the gear the better the mpg because the engine doesn't have to turn the rpm's that would if it had or has a lower gear ratio
